How to connect Bigin by Zoho CRM and Google Meet

Create a New Scenario to Connect Bigin by Zoho CRM and Google Meet

In the workspace, click the “Create New Scenario” button.

Add the First Step

Add the first node – a trigger that will initiate the scenario when it receives the required event. Triggers can be scheduled, called by a Bigin by Zoho CRM, triggered by another scenario, or executed manually (for testing purposes). In most cases, Bigin by Zoho CRM or Google Meet will be your first step. To do this, click "Choose an app," find Bigin by Zoho CRM or Google Meet, and select the appropriate trigger to start the scenario.

Add the Bigin by Zoho CRM Node

Select the Bigin by Zoho CRM node from the app selection panel on the right.

Save and Activate the Scenario

After configuring Bigin by Zoho CRM, Google Meet, and any additional nodes, don’t forget to save the scenario and click "Deploy." Activating the scenario ensures it will run automatically whenever the trigger node receives input or a condition is met. By default, all newly created scenarios are deactivated.

Test the Scenario

Run the scenario by clicking “Run once” and triggering an event to check if the Bigin by Zoho CRM and Google Meet integration works as expected. Depending on your setup, data should flow between Bigin by Zoho CRM and Google Meet (or vice versa). Easily troubleshoot the scenario by reviewing the execution history to identify and fix any issues.

Are there any limitations to the Bigin by Zoho CRM and Google Meet integration on Latenode?

While the integration is powerful, there are certain limitations to be aware of:

  • Google Meet recording storage depends on your Google Workspace plan limits.
  • Bigin by Zoho CRM API rate limits may affect high-volume data processing.
  • Advanced customization via JavaScript requires coding expertise.
